    Heard great things about this place so I drove across town to give this hole in the wall place a try. All I have to say is... Fantastic wings (great flavor choices too). To be honest when I got there I was skeptical about getting out of my car but since a lot of my friends praised about the wings here I had to give it a try and glad I did. I tried the Hot Wings, Thai Chili, lemon pepper and garlic parm. You can't go wrong with any of them but my absolute favorite are the Thai Chili wings. Give this place a try, you won't be disappointed!

    Place used to be a sonic back in the day that was converted into a wing place that also serves fried rice....okay. fries need less salt. The garlic parmesan wings need more parmesan and served with less garlic sauce. The spicey Korean was way to sweet, waste of time that. The mild was actually perfect. My wife cant even have spicey and it was perfect for her and full of flavor for me. Fried rice was made wrong. All in all ud come back for a big order of mild wings but nothing else. The sweet tea was garbage btw.

    Not my cup of tea. I eat a low carb diet daily so eating carbs is an extra special treat. My mom…read moreand I were out shopping and she found this option for brunch on Google. The thought of a large fluffy homemade biscuit with gravy or homemade jelly sounded so yummy. I was driving so didn't have time to review the menu, reviews or photos on Yelp that I usually do. It's really hard to disappoint at a southern breakfast spot. It is a very small very, quaint place which seemed perfect for just us. Like maybe 4 tables total small. Again, still perfect for just us two. Like having biscuits in your grandma's kitchen, literally. They have a ton of Louisiana items and foods for sale. Again, something I love!! They even had beeswax candles made locally. However, very few things, like one of the 4 items I looked at had a price. I should not have to go ask the price of each item. The menu was lacking and difficult to understand. After starring at it and not really seeing a perfect fit, just went to the counter and told her I wanted the biscuits and gravy, hash brown and bacon. There weren't meals on the menu. I love biscuits, I thought, as much as anyone else from Louisiana but that isn't breakfast. I need some eggs and meat for sure, grits and hash browns are expected on a southern breakfast menu. They have no eggs and no grits, just biscuits, hash brown, sausage and bacon. The biscuits were super tall, super dense and hard crust all the way around. So tall that the sausage biscuit is one that you can't get your mouth around and hard. My mom disassembled it to eat it and had to cut it with a knife. I had in my mind thick, fluffy, piping hot biscuits right out of the oven. These were dense, hard and reheated biscuits. I'm positive because some parts were hot hot and others cool to the touch. The hash brown looked like the one from McDonald's but maybe cooked in the oven instead and reheated. Definitely not worth the cost or calories. The bacon was delicious and crispy. The sausage gravy had an unusual taste. I couldn't tell if it was a different seasoning than I am use to or just cheap sausage that had an unusual flavor. I wish I would have taken more photos. I won't be back and highly recommend First Watch, Another Broken Egg or Strawns instead.
